If I try to run "strace sudo echo foo", then it complains about the effective UID not being 0, both on working and non-working systems.
Run this as root: # strace -u your_username sudo echo foo
Thanks, that worked! It turned out that Factory needs CONFIG_AUDIT, whereas 13.2 did not.
I've filed a bug to report the silent failure: https://bugzilla.opensuse.org/show_bug.cgi?id=918953
